基于电子白板设备的触控方法、系统及触摸设备与流程

文档序号:17987316发布日期:2019-06-22 00:30阅读:441来源:国知局
基于电子白板设备的触控方法、系统及触摸设备与流程

本发明涉及智能白板领域,更具体的说,是一种基于电子白板设备的触控方法、系统及触摸设备。



背景技术:

目前的android电子白板大屏在多个应用之间切换比较麻烦,由于电子白板大屏的尺寸一般在75英寸以上,所有控制应用返回或者主页的按钮摆放就是一个大问题,如果用户站在大屏的左边,而这些按键不在屏幕的左边时,用户需要移步到合适的位置去按按键,用户操作比较多时,这样来回的走动对操作带来不便,而采用手势滑动调出按键的方式会造成操作过多和误操作,比如单指长按屏幕调出按键的方式,如果单指按下的地方本身就能够触发应用,则会造成错误的操作,多指长按屏幕调出按钮的方式,在支持多点书写的电子白板下,就跟写字有冲突。



技术实现要素:

本发明的目的在于提供一种基于电子白板设备的触控方法、系统及触摸设备,通过该触控方法可方便调出虚拟按键,同时可避免调出虚拟按键的误操作。

其技术方案如下:

本发明公开一种基于电子白板设备的触控方法,包括以下步骤:

检测触摸屏的触摸区域内是否有触摸笔进行触摸操作;

判断触摸笔的触摸宽度是否满足第一预设条件;

若触摸笔的触摸宽度满足第一预设条件,则记录触摸笔的触摸轨迹,并将触摸数据发送至操作系统;

否则,判断触摸笔的触摸宽度是否满足第二预设条件;

若触摸笔的触摸宽度满足第二预设条件,则判断触摸笔的触摸操作是否满足第三预设条件;

若触摸笔的触摸操作满足第三预设条件,则调出并于发生触摸操作位置处显示虚拟按键。

调出并于发生触摸操作位置处显示虚拟按键,还包括:

点击触摸区域内虚拟按键以外的区域,则隐藏虚拟按键。

所述第一预设条件为:

所述触摸笔的触摸宽度为1mm至3mm。

所述第二预设条件为:

所述触摸笔的触摸宽度为7mm至9mm。

所述第三预设条件为:

所述触摸笔在500ms内发生两次按下并抬起的触摸操作。

若触摸笔的触摸操作满足第三预设条件,则调出并于发生触摸操作位置处显示虚拟按键,具体为:

若触摸笔的触摸操作满足第三预设条件;

触摸框发送第二次触摸操作的触摸坐标至操作系统;

并发送一个触摸轨迹宽度为1000mm的触摸数据至操作系统;

操作系统调出并显示虚拟按键于触摸区域。

所述虚拟按键显示于发生第二次按下并抬起的触摸操作的位置。

在判断触摸笔的触摸操作是否满足第三预设条件之前,还包括步骤:

触摸笔的触摸宽度满足第二预设条件;

触摸框记录触摸笔的触摸坐标。

本发明还公开一种基于电子白板设备的触控系统,包括:

触摸屏,该触摸屏上具有触摸区域;

触摸框,该触摸框位于所述触摸屏的四周,所述触摸框用于检测触摸屏的触摸区域的触摸操作;

操作系统,触摸屏及所述触摸框与所述操作系统电性相连;

触摸笔,该触摸笔用于在触摸屏上进行触摸操作,该触摸笔具有第一书写头及第二书写头,所述第一书写头的触摸宽度为1mm至3mm,所述第二书写头的触摸宽度为7mm至9mm。

本发明还公开一种触摸设备,所述触摸设备具有如上述所述的触控系统。

下面对本发明的优点或原理进行说明:

1、触摸笔在触摸屏的触摸区域进行触摸操作,若触摸宽度满足第一预设条件,则为书写模式,触摸框记录触摸笔的书写轨迹;若触摸笔的触摸宽度满足第二预设条件,且触摸操作满足第三预设条件,则显示虚拟按键,通过不同的触摸宽度及触摸操作,即可区分书写模式及虚拟按键显示模式,避免调出虚拟按键的误操作,虚拟按键调出较为方便,同时,虚拟按键显示在发生触摸操作的位置,避免了操作者在触摸屏前来回走动。

2、显示虚拟按键后,使用触摸笔点击虚拟按键以外的区域即可隐藏虚拟按键,隐藏虚拟按键不需要满足第一预设条件或第二预设条件或第三预设条件,虚拟按键的隐藏简单方便。

3、第一预设条件的触摸宽度为1mm至3mm,即使用触摸笔的第一书写头进行触摸操作,第二预设条件的触摸宽度为7mm至9mm,即使用触摸笔的第二书写头进行触摸操作,而成人手指的宽度一般为1.5cm至2cm,通过设置第一预设条件及第二预设条件,可避免通过手指触摸产生的误操作。

4、第三预设条件为使用触摸笔的第二书写头500ms内在触摸屏上发生两次按下并抬起的触摸操作,通过设置调出虚拟按键的预设条件,避免通过触摸笔的第一书写头书写时调出虚拟按键,避免书写操作与调出虚拟按键操作的冲突。

5、当用第二书写头进行触摸操作时,触摸框记录发生触摸操作的坐标,便于虚拟按键显示位置的确定。

附图说明

图1是本实施例的基于电子白板设备的触控方法的流程图。

具体实施方式

下面对本发明的实施例进行详细说明。

本实施例公开一种基于电子白板设备的触控系统,该触控系统包括触摸屏、触摸框、操作系统及触摸笔,其中,该触摸屏上设有触摸区域,同时该触摸屏具有上侧边、下侧边、左侧边及右侧边,上侧边与下侧边相对,左侧边与右侧边相对,触摸框分别位于触摸屏的上侧边、下侧边、左侧边及右侧边,相对的两个触摸框上,其中一个触摸框上设有红外发射管,另一个触摸框上设有红外接收管,本实施例的触摸框用于检测触摸屏的触摸区域的触摸操作,本实施例的触摸屏及触摸框均与操作系统电性相连,该操作系统为android系统,本实施例的触摸笔用于在触摸屏的触摸区域内进行触摸操作,且该触摸笔具有第一书写头及第二书写头,第一书写头及第二书写头分别位于触摸笔的相对的两端,其中,第一书写头的书写宽度为1mm至3mm,优选的为2mm,第二书写头的书写宽度为7mm至9mm,优选的为8mm,本实施例的触摸工具不限于触摸笔,其他与触摸笔具有同等触摸宽度的其他物体也可以;

本实施例还公开一种触摸设备,该触摸设备具有如上述所述的触控系统;

本实施例还公开了基于电子白板设备的触控系统的触控方法,该触控方法包括以下步骤:

s100:检测触摸屏的触摸区域内是否有触摸笔进行触摸操作;

s200:判断触摸笔的触摸宽度是否满足第一预设条件;

s300:若触摸笔的触摸宽度满足第一预设条件,则记录触摸笔的触摸轨迹,并将触摸数据发送至操作系统;

s400:否则,判断触摸笔的触摸宽度是否满足第二预设条件;

s500:若触摸笔的触摸宽度满足第二预设条件,则判断触摸笔的触摸操作是否满足第三预设条件;

s600:若触摸笔的触摸操作满足第三预设条件,则调出并于发生触摸操作位置处显示虚拟按键;

其中本实施例的所述第一预设条件为:所述触摸笔的触摸宽度为1mm至3mm,优选的为2mm;所述第二预设条件为:所述触摸笔的触摸宽度为7mm至9mm,优选的为8mm;所述第三预设条件为:所述触摸笔在500ms内发生两次按下并抬起的触摸操作;

其中若触摸笔的触摸操作满足第三预设条件,则调出并于发生触摸操作位置处显示虚拟按键,具体为:

若触摸笔的触摸操作满足第三预设条件;

触摸框发送第二次触摸操作的触摸坐标至操作系统;

并发送一个触摸轨迹宽度为1000mm的触摸数据至操作系统;

操作系统调出并显示虚拟按键于触摸区域;

所述虚拟按键显示于发生第二次按下并抬起的触摸操作的位置;

在判断触摸笔的触摸操作是否满足第三预设条件之前,还包括步骤:

触摸笔的宽度满足第二预设条件;

触摸框记录触摸笔的触摸坐标。

调出并显示虚拟按键后,通过使用触摸笔的第一书写头或第二书写头点击触摸区域内虚拟按键以外的区域,则可隐藏虚拟按键;

本实施例中第三预设条件为触摸笔的第二书写头在500ms内发生两次按下并抬起的触摸操作,在其他实施例中,还可设置为第二书写头在500ms内发生三次或四次等按下并抬起的触摸操作,还可设置为在300ms内发生两次或多次按下并抬起的触摸操作;本实施例的第三预设条件的触摸操作为按下并抬起,在其他实施例中还可设置为其他触摸操作。

下面对本实施例的优点或原理进行说明:

1、触摸笔在触摸屏的触摸区域进行触摸操作,若触摸宽度满足第一预设条件,则为书写模式,触摸框记录触摸笔的书写轨迹;若触摸笔的触摸宽度满足第二预设条件,且触摸操作满足第三预设条件,则显示虚拟按键,通过不同的触摸宽度及触摸操作,即可区分书写模式及虚拟按键显示模式,避免调出虚拟按键的误操作,虚拟按键调出较为方便,同时,虚拟按键显示在发生触摸操作的位置,避免了操作者在触摸屏前来回走动。

2、显示虚拟按键后,使用触摸笔点击虚拟按键以外的区域即可隐藏虚拟按键,隐藏虚拟按键不需要满足第一预设条件或第二预设条件或第三预设条件,虚拟按键的隐藏简单方便。

3、第一预设条件的触摸宽度为1mm至3mm,即使用触摸笔的第一书写头进行触摸操作,第二预设条件的触摸宽度为7mm至9mm,即使用触摸笔的第二书写头进行触摸操作,而成人手指的宽度一般为1.5cm至2cm,通过设置第一预设条件及第二预设条件,可避免通过手指触摸产生的误操作。

4、第三预设条件为使用触摸笔的第二书写头500ms内在触摸屏上发生两次按下并抬起的触摸操作,通过设置调出虚拟按键的预设条件,避免通过触摸笔的第一书写头书写时调出虚拟按键,避免书写操作与调出虚拟按键操作的冲突。

5、当用第二书写头进行触摸操作时,触摸框记录发生触摸操作的坐标,便于虚拟按键显示位置的确定。

以上仅为本发明的具体实施例,并不以此限定本发明的保护范围;在不违反本发明构思的基础上所作的任何替换与改进,均属本发明的保护范围。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1